The Fort Meade library will offer too book signings by local authors. Both are open to the public.
- Author James Battee will sign copies of his novel, "Double Trouble on Corned Beef Row," on Sept. 13 from 5:30 p.m. to 7:30 p.m. at the Medal of Honor Library. This is Battee’s first novel, which is set in Baltimore.
- Author Mary Doyle will sign copies of her book, "I’m Still Standing," on Sept. 15 from 5:30 p.m. to 7:30 p.m. at the Medal of Honor Library. "I’m Still Standing" tells the story of Shoshana Johnson, the first female black prisoner of war in United States history. The book, co-authored with Johnson, was nominated for a NAACP Image Award.
